What makes selling in Mackay & Whitsundays unique?

The Mackay & Whitsundays region is a place of clear contrasts. Mackay itself operates as the regional service and processing centre for sugar, agriculture and coastal industry, while the Whitsundays are the major tourism engine with Airlie Beach, Cannonvale and Hamilton Island anchoring visitor demand. Inland, Isaac and towns such as Moranbah and Dysart are significant mining centres with a workforce profile and sales rhythm very different to the coastal market. Median prices show strong advance, up 17.3% on the year to $645,000, the highest level in five years, though the pace may not be sustained, and the median is 1.6% above the prior peak set in April 2026.

That mix means sellers here are often balancing local owner-occupiers and families in Mackay with holiday-home buyers and investors drawn to the Whitsundays, plus a steady pool of mining-related purchasers for inland properties. Portside activity around Hay Point and Mackay Harbour, together with ongoing upgrades to regional road and air links, is supporting both freight and visitor flows and making some coastal pockets more attractive to holiday buyers. Homes are selling in a median of 40 days, much the same pace as a year ago. Auctions are clearing at 36% over the past year.(1) There have been fewer sales than a year ago, down 14.9% on the year, the lowest transaction count in three years.

The average commission rate is 2.85% (around $18,000 on a median-priced home). Real estate agents in the Mackay & Whitsundays region may need longer campaigns and broader marketing reach to connect with holiday buyers, mining workers and local families, so rates often increase to reflect those longer campaign periods and wider promotion.
